The IETF TRILL (TRansparent Interconnection of Lots of Links)
standard provides least cost pair-wise data forwarding without
configuration in multi-hop networks with arbitrary topology, safe
forwarding even during periods of temporary loops, and support for
multipathing of both unicast and multicast traffic. TRILL
accomplishes this by using IS-IS (Intermediate System to Intermediate
System) link state routing and by encapsulating traffic using a
header that includes a hop count. Devices that implement TRILL are
called RBridges.
Since the TRILL base protocol was approved in March 2010, active
development of TRILL has revealed corner cases that could use
clarification and a few errors in the original RFC 6325. RFCs 6327,
XXXX, and YYYY, provide clarifications with respect to Adjacency,
Appointed Forwarders, and the TRILL ESADI protocol. This document
provide other known clarifications and corrections and updates RFC
6325 and RFC 6327.
